Description:

A sublime ballerina flat is unveiled in the polished 'Pallino'. Sumptuous leather uppers with a darling bow needs no break-in period. Elasticized toeline for a secure fit. Shock-absorbent quilted polyfoam footbed reduces foot fatigue to keep you moving from day to night. Stable SSR outsole will last and last. 1/2" heel.

Features:
  • Leather lining is breathable and absorbs moisture

  • Leather uppers are supple and breathable

4A great shoe for the money  Feb 06, 2009
By Gogo Shopping!
I wear a 6.5 in most BCBG (which usually run a half size big) and a 7 in most other shoes--puma, adidas, franco, tommy, aigner--once in a while I wear a 7.5.

This was my first pair of Indigo or Clark shoes so I ordered the black leather in both a 7 and a 7.5 (6.5 wasn't avaliable). I honestly couldn't decide which size to keep! In the end I kept the 7.5 because I liked the way shoe fit around the ball of my foot, which is usually sore. If I had it to do over I think I would go with the 7 because I have quite a lot of room (1/2-3/4 inch) between my big toe and the top of the shoe in the 7.5. Still, the shoe doesn't slip or look too big because the elastic around the entire opening keeps it comfortably in place. Anyway, I would say the shoe runs true to size, and if you order a half size up I think you'll be fine too.

As far as comfort goes, these shoes have a lot more cushion/support than most flats I have seen, but they are not like eccos by any means (on a 1-10 scale I would rate an ecco a 9.5 and this shoe a 6.5).

The sole on this shoe has a couple layers which, beginning inside the shoe, are as follows:

thin (probably leather) liner inside the shoe--embroidered `indigo' logo
1/8" foam that lines the entire sole
1/16" flexible black plastic inside the shoe that thins as it approaches the toe, and disappears before the ball of the foot
1/16" a more durable pink foam-ish substance runs parallel to the black plastic
outsole:
foam 1/4" that thins as it approaches the toe, and disappears before the ball of the foot
rubber 1/4" across the entire shoe--thins to ~1/8" as it comes toward the toe

This shoe is a good purchase-- though it won't make sore feet feel better, it has enough cushion not to aggravate foot pain. I didn't notice an arch in this shoe, but I have a pretty high arch. Good luck!
